On Wed, 11 Dec 2002, Eric Gillespie wrote:

> In another post, Jan reveals why the stdio.h problem was not
> obvious until i tried to build: s/gnu-linux.h includes stdio.h.
> This sort of thing is bound to happen again in the future, which
> is why i suggest that it is better to include the headers you
> need, rather than relying on system-dependent header files to do
> it for you.

FWIW, I agree.  I didn't check in this particular case, but I'm guessing 
that s/gnu-linux.h included stdio.h because it used something from that 
header.  Other system-dependent headers might not do that.  Including 
stdio.h in each of the *.c files that use stdio will thus prevent 
compilation problems on some platforms.
